On Sat, Apr 15, 2006 at 16:58:47 +0200, Goswin von Brederlow wrote:

> xbase-clients Build-Depends on ssh | rsh, which means it pulls in
> openssh-server and openssh-client into the buildd chroot and generate
> new host keys. Something that uses up a lot of entropy and takes a
> long time on e.g. m68k.
> 
Fixed in x11-session-utils (split out from xbase-clients in
experimental).

Bug#433876: xserver-xorg-video-ati: brightness buttons don't work on compaq nc6000

2007-07-19 Thread John Wright
Package: xserver-xorg-video-ati
Version: 1:6.6.3-2
Severity: normal

I have a compaq nc6000 laptop, and the brightness buttons don't work if
I use x.org's ati driver.  They do work with fglrx, and they used to
work with the free ati driver in sarge.  Unfortunately, I can't work
around this by switching virtual terminals and changing brightness
there, since the buttons will not work at all after X starts -- I have
to restart the machine for the buttons to work again.
